Halfway House - Alcohol and Drug Rehabilitation Centers - Lincolnton, NC.

When an individual has rehabilitated from a substance abuse problem, it isn't as simple as starting life again where you left off. Restoring a positive and happy life takes time and a great deal of determination. A Halfway House, a.k.a. a Sober Living Facility, is an environment where people in recovery can live in a clean and sober and supportive setting until they can live confidently on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a condition of a person's probation for example, or the individual could make the decision to live in a Halfway House of their own will following drug or alcohol treatment. In either case, residents of a Halfway House are clean and striving to do what is necessary to repair their lives. This could mean getting one's GED, getting a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in Lincolnton are run by individuals who in most cases were once occupants of the house. The duration an individual is permitted to stay at the Halfway House will differ, but it's commonly an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Tenants must undergo alcohol and drug testing before being accepted into the house, and this testing will continue randomly to be certain there isn't any drug use in the house or substance abuse issues that would be more effectively addressed in a drug or alcohol rehabilitation facility.
